Our biological technologies help rebuild soil organic matter, reduce carbon emissions, and preserve water resources.
Replacing 25-40% of synthetic nitrogen and phosphatic fertilizers reduces greenhouse gas emissions associated with chemical fertilizer synthesis.
Bio-fertilizer microbes fix nutrients directly in the root zone, preventing nitrate leaching into farm wells and drinking water aquifers.
Re-introduces millions of beneficial bacteria, mycorrhizae, and saprophytic fungi that revive dead soils and enhance earthworm populations.
Arka Waste Decomposer enables farmers to convert crop residues into rich organic humus directly in the field, ending residue burning pollution.
